Output d104acbd620858ea4bb8a7315f145585bcdc26dcd1e6b276c6f8a05dfcee0305:5

value
31096721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e9ba0bd8c36196798f2727857ef3c07e30a46119d9c75d72c48f55ce5a76d7a9
address
bc1paxaqhkxrvxt8nre8y7zhau7q0cc2gcgem8r46uky3a2uuknk675sexeflz
transaction
d104acbd620858ea4bb8a7315f145585bcdc26dcd1e6b276c6f8a05dfcee0305
spent
true